Celebrating the last great Anglo Saxon King of England, Harold Godwinson In the Autumn of 1066, the English King Harold II was shot in the eye by a Norman arrow before being slain at the Battle of Hastings. The legend is well known and the details sometimes disputed. Harold's death and loss in battle allowed the Norman invaders, led by William, to conquer England.
